The molar mass of copper(II) chloride (CuCl2) is 134.45 g/mol. How many formula units of CuCl2 are present in 17.6 g of CuCl2? 7.88 × 1022 formula units 1.84 × 1023 formula units 1.91 × 1023 formula units 1.42 × 1024 formula units
